WINNIPEG — One of the city’s oldest bridges is closing for nine days in July, while it undergoes repairs.
Louise Bridge will be closed to traffic from Nairn Avenue to Sutherland Avenue starting Saturday at 6 a.m. until July 24 at at 6 p.m.

Pedestrians will be able to use the bridge while the work is underway.
Access to the Buchanan Marine Boat Launch will also be available.
The maintenance includes asphalt resurfacing and concrete deck repairs.
